City Information

Newark, NJ

Newark, NJ - NWK-0Newark, NJ - NWK-1Newark, NJ - NWK-2

As the most populous city in New Jersey, Newark offers some excellent museums, parks and restaurants that you can enjoy year-round. Art lovers should stop by the famous Newark Museum to enjoy a rich collection of works by American artists and sculptors. History buffs should check out the New Jersey Historical Society for ongoing exhibitions documenting the state’s rich history.

Located by the Passaic River, Newark offers various places where you can enjoy a relaxing stroll by the water. For the best views, head over to the city’s Riverfront Park near the hip Ironbound neighborhood. If you’re seeking more outdoor enjoyment, check out Branch Brook Park where you will find various lakes and plenty of cherry blossoms.

Newark is one of the biggest travel hubs in the United States, which makes it very easily accessible via all types of transportation. The Newark Liberty International Airport is one of the three airports that serves the New York City metro area, and its close proximity to Newark’s Penn Station makes it easy to reach from anywhere via bus or train.

Youngstown, OH

Youngstown, OH - YTN-0Youngstown, OH - YTN-1Youngstown, OH - YTN-2

A vibrant young city in Ohio, Youngstown has seen an uptick in popularity in recent years, quickly becoming a local cultural center. One must-see destination is the Youngstown Historical Center of Industry and Labor. This museum documents the rise and fall of the steel industry in Youngstown, along with the lasting legacy it leaves behind. For a date night, check out the Oakland Center for the Arts, where you can watch plays written by local authors. Mill Creek Metroparks features gardens, lakes, and woodlands for a quiet day surrounded by gorgeous landscapes.

Jefferson Lines and Barons Bus Lines offer easy transport into Youngstown from surrounding cities. Youngstown Warren Regional Airport is available, but most flights will likely go through Akron’s airport, about 40 miles away.

Where does the bus arrive in Youngstown?

Main arrival station: Bus Terminal - 340 W Federal St

Youngstown's bus terminal on Federal Street is a Greyhound station, but Jefferson Lines and Barons Bus Lines also operate routes through this location. The station features a spacious waiting lounge for bus passengers, and public restrooms are available. The station has vending machines, but you can also walk a few blocks down Federal Street to have a more substantial meal at one of Youngstown's restaurants. There are multiple bus bays at the terminal, so be sure to pay attention to which bus you board. Popular destinations for buses leaving this station include Columbus, Pittsburgh, and New York.
